#8ba4c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8ba4cc is composed of 54.5% red, 64.3%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 216.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 67.3%. #8ba4c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#174999.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8ba4cc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8ba4cc has RGB values of R:139, G:164,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 9151692.

Hex triplet 8ba4cc #8ba4cc
RGB Decimal 139, 164, 204 rgb(139,164,204)
RGB Percent 54.5, 64.3, 80 rgb(54.5%,64.3%,80%)
CMYK 32, 20, 0, 20
HSL 216.9°, 38.9, 67.3 hsl(216.9,38.9%,67.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 216.9°, 31.9, 80
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 66.823, 0.769, -23.251
XYZ 34.82, 36.399, 62.314
xyY 0.261, 0.273, 36.399
CIE-LCH 66.823, 23.264, 271.893
CIE-LUV 66.823, -14.269, -36.179
Hunter-Lab 60.331, -2.56, -19.007
Binary 10001011, 10100100, 11001100

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#8ba4cc is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a1a1a1 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9da2aa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#9da5cc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a0a4d0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#8bacb9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#96a5cc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#98a4ce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#8ba9c0 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
